On May 18, GRVTY announced the launch of Maritime Technologies, a new organization within the company’s CTO office dedicated to delivering breakthrough capability across the maritime domain. Built to meet the urgency of today’s contested seas, Maritime Technologies unifies a portfolio of proven technologies spanning four pillars critical to modern naval operations: autonomy, endurance, precision navigation, and scale, the company said.

As adversary investments in maritime systems accelerate and the demand for distributed, survivable forces grows, Maritime Technologies is purpose-built to give the U.S. and allied warfighters the tools to outpace the threat. It brings together a suite of prototype, fielded, and field-ready systems under a single mission: deliver innovation on the high seas, at the speed of relevance.

“Along with our compelling portfolio in space, spectrum, and cyber, the maritime domain is where the next decade of strategic competition will be decided,” said Dr. Phil Root, chief technology officer of GRVTY and head of Maritime Technologies. “Maritime Technologies is our answer: a focused, mission-driven team that puts autonomy, range, precision navigation, and scale directly in the hands of the operators who need them most.”

On April 21, GRVTY, a leading defense technology company, and Colorado-based DeNOVO, introduced Coalition Edge, a distributed edge analytics capability delivering real-time geospatial intelligence (GEOINT) and RF-driven insight across connected, congested, degraded and denied operational environments.

Coalition Edge is a cross-company collaboration that delivers edgeless connectivity and mission‑ready intelligence. The integrated solution ensures a continuous flow of data, analytics and insights across dynamic operational conditions, enabling greater situational awareness and decision support without reliance on persistent networks or centralized infrastructure.

Coalition members and their contributions include:

GRVTY: Mission analytics and orchestration layer powered by Origin, GRVTY’s automated intelligence platform, transforming multi-INT edge and cloud outputs into prioritized, auditable, and releasable intelligence products that enable interoperability between intelligence and other warfighting functions across dynamic, bandwidth-limited operational environments.

DeNOVO Solutions: Coalition organizer and lead integrator, responsible for interoperability, analytics augmentation, and orchestration across distributed edge and cloud environments.

Hewlett Packard Enterprise (HPE): Tactical edge compute, providing ruggedized infrastructure for low-latency processing and sustained AI/ML performance at the edge.

NVIDIA: AI/ML acceleration, enabling real-time inference and standardized model deployment across edge and cloud environments.

Rancher Government Services: Infrastructure and application orchestration, managing containerized services and lifecycle operations across distributed environments.

T‑Mobile: Resilient connectivity backbone, supporting secure transport, priority routing, and continuity of operations across connected and degraded conditions.

Urban Sky: Stratospheric sensing and collection layer, providing EO and full‑motion video data from high-altitude balloon platforms to support interoperable, multi‑INT edge analytics.

The concept of edgeless connectivity captures and addresses an operational reality in which systems function across connected, intermittently connected and fully disconnected states, regardless of connectivity conditions.

“Coalition Edge is about turning distributed data into actionable intelligence, even in adverse conditions,” said Katie Selbe, chief executive officer at GRVTY. “Through our Origin platform, we’re demonstrating how multi‑INT data collected at the edge can be fused, orchestrated, and delivered as prioritized, auditable intelligence fast enough to support real mission decisions.”

On March 4, GRVTY announced that it has been awarded a $75 million agreement under a One Nation Innovation Other Transaction Agreement (OTA) to deliver emerging C5ISR capabilities as part of a critical Navy program.

Specifically, GRVTY will provide proven advanced analytical methods, software, comprehensive data models, and highly skilled subject matter expertise, ultimately yielding operationally ready prototypes that unlock new C5ISR capabilities.

“Now more than ever, speed is imperative to keeping America safe and secure,” said Katie Selbe, GRVTY’s chief executive officer. “We are ready to rapidly develop and deploy next-generation capabilities for the U.S. Navy to support their most critical, consequential, and demanding missions.”

The OTA has an initial value of $75 million, with the potential for additional awards. This agreement provides for streamlined contracting and management practices, allowing GRVTY to deliver mission impact, faster.

“We’ll be providing mission and technical expertise that knows how to outpace the threat,” said Johnnie Simpson, GRVTY’s general manager of cyber engineering. “Under this agreement, GRVTY will deliver rapid, cost-effective, and innovative C5ISR warfighting solutions across all domains that are driven by the most significant national security requirements and opportunities.”

The company will perform this cutting-edge work at contractor facilities, naval systems commands, fleet concentration areas, deployed naval platforms, or expeditionary sites.

On February 23, GRVTY announced the appointment of Peter Ranks as chief strategy officer. In this role, Ranks will advance the company’s strategic plan, initiatives, and expansion into new mission areas.

“Pete is an exceptional addition to the GRVTY executive leadership team,” said Katie Selbe, GRVTY’s chief executive officer. “Through his service to the nation both at the Central Intelligence Agency and the Department of War, he has earned a perspective few possess. GRVTY has been growing intentionally, and Pete’s ability to anticipate and act on the nexus of strategic context, technology, and mission is second to none.”

Ranks has devoted his career to national security. Prior to GRVTY, Ranks spent 27 years at the CIA where he began his tenure as a network engineer, ultimately concluding as the first Assistant Director of the CIA for Cyber Intelligence. In prior roles, Ranks supported the CIA’s counterproliferation and counterterrorism missions and managed the Intelligence Community’s first cloud computing partnership with industry.

Additionally, he served as a Deputy Chief Information Officer at the DoW, providing leadership for the Cloud Computing Program Office and Department software modernization efforts under the DoW Chief Information Officer.

“What drew me to GRVTY is the vision and ambition of the company,” said Ranks. “We’re at a pivotal moment in our nation’s security, and GRVTY’s focus on embracing and developing the latest defense technologies, delivering field-ready mission solutions, and doing what’s in the warfighter’s best interest, all at speed and scale, is what fundamentally sets this company apart from all the rest. I am thrilled to join the team.”

On February 17, GRVTY announced it will establish its new corporate headquarters at 8270 Greensboro Drive in Tysons, Va., situated in Northern Virginia’s defense and technology corridor.

The 22,000+ square-foot facility will house GRVTY’s corporate leadership and operations. It will also become the first of many “Centers of GRVTY” for the company – purpose-built places that are designed to encourage mission-critical innovation at speed and scale.

Designed with a people-first philosophy, the headquarters features modern, collaborative workspaces, flexible team areas, natural lighting, and wellness accommodations to support productivity, creativity, and connection. The facility also includes areas to host working sessions, hands-on demonstrations, and discussions with customers and partners.

“Establishing this location is a strategic step forward for GRVTY,” said Katie Selbe, chief executive officer of GRVTY. “Our headquarters is not only a place to work – it’s where we inspire next generation thinking to drive meaningful innovation all across the company, directly advancing our national security.”

According to the company, the new headquarters represents more than a physical expansion – it’s a commitment to advancing national security through trusted collaboration, bold innovation, and a culture that puts people and mission first. In addition to this expansion, GRVTY plans to hire highly skilled engineers, technologists, scientists, and corporate staff.

On October 27, GRVTY, a national security company, announced that it has appointed Major General Ryan Heritage, USMC, Retired, to its advisory board.

“With decades of service and distinguished achievement in national security, Ryan brings extraordinary leadership and experience to GRVTY,” said Katie Selbe, GRVTY’s chief executive officer. “From leading Marines in the field to commanding cyber, space, and information forces – and culminating as director of operations at U.S. Cyber Command – he offers unparalleled insight that will strengthen our corporate strategy as we expand capabilities and technologies that advance and accelerate national security.”

Heritage began his career as an infantry officer serving with both the II and III Marine Expeditionary Force as well as several supporting establishment and joint commands. He then commanded the Marine Corps Recruit Depot San Diego and Western Recruiting Region followed by command of Marine Corps Forces Cyberspace Command, Marine Corps Forces Space Command and the Marine Corps Information Command. He retired after serving as the Director of Operations, J3, U.S. Cyber Command.

He graduated from the George Washington University in 1990 and was commissioned through the Naval Reserve Officer Training Corps program.

Heritage will join Dave Abba, Phil Root and Dave Sterling on the GRVTY advisory board, an organization that provides counsel on corporate strategy and direction.

On September 29, GRVTY announced that the company has named Dr. Phil Root as chief technology officer (CTO). In this role, he will set and drive the company’s technology vision. Root’s appointment underscores GRVTY’s commitment to accelerating innovation and strengthening U.S. national security capabilities, according to the company.

“Phil joins GRVTY at a pivotal moment,” said Katie Selbe, GRVTY’s chief executive officer. “His deep technical expertise and proven leadership will be instrumental as we scale our capabilities, strengthen our partnerships, and deliver mission impact for our customers.”

A retired Army lieutenant colonel and MIT-trained aerospace engineer, Root is a distinguished research and development leader with decades of operational and technical experience. He joined GRVTY from DARPA, where he served as director of the Strategic Technology Office and previously as deputy director and acting director of the Defense Sciences Office.

“GRVTY is harnessing the best emerging and proven technologies that ultimately deliver more impact for American national security,” said Root. “Alongside our customers and mission partners, we will accelerate innovation, close critical capability gaps, and ensure the United States stays ahead of adversaries in every domain of competition. Our commitment is simple: deliver solutions that strengthen deterrence today and prepare for the challenges of tomorrow.”

Root has led groundbreaking programs in AI-infused autonomy, counter-UAS, tunneling, and the lunar economy, with operational experience spanning deployments in Afghanistan, support to the NASA Astronaut Office, and an Apache helicopter pilot tour in Germany and South Korea.

On September 10, GRVTY announced that it has appointed Major General Dave Abba, USAF, Retired, to its advisory board.

“With nearly three decades of service to the country, Dave is a tremendous leader,” said Katie Selbe, GRVTY’s chief executive officer. “He will add invaluable insight to GRVTY’s corporate strategy as we expand our capabilities and technologies that advance and accelerate national security.”

Abba started his career in the Air Force flying the F-15C Eagle and later the F-22A Raptor, where he commanded at the squadron, group, and wing levels. As a wing commander, he led the most complex wing in the Air Force with responsibilities including operational test and evaluation, weapons system evaluation, and electronic warfare reprogramming. In that role, he recognized the criticality of the electromagnetic spectrum to warfighting and championed the creation of the 350th Spectrum Warfare Wing.

As a general officer, he served as the Director of the Air Force F-35 Integration Office and later as Director of the Special Access Program Central Office. In this role, Abba successfully led significant reforms to special access programs and policy.

He graduated from the Air Force Academy in 1995 and later earned master’s degrees from the College of Naval Command and Staff with distinction and the Dwight D. Eisenhower School for National Security and Resource Strategy as a distinguished graduate.

Abba will join Phil Root and Dave Sterling on the GRVTY Advisory Board, an organization that provides counsel on corporate strategy and direction.

On July 22, GRVTY announced the formation of its advisory board. The company is honored to appoint Dr. Phil Root and Dave Sterling as its first named advisors.

Phil Root, Ph.D — Retired Army Lt. Col., MIT-trained aerospace engineer, and renowned research and development leader — joins GRVTY after serving as director of DARPA’s Strategic Technology Office, and previously as deputy director and acting director of DARPA’s Defense Sciences Office. He has led pioneering programs in AI infused autonomy, counter-UAS, tunneling technologies, the lunar economy, and ethical analysis of autonomous systems. Root’s operational background includes deployments in Afghanistan, support to the NASA Astronaut Office, and an Apache helicopter pilot tour in Germany and South Korea.

Dave Sterling — founder and CEO of Royce Geospatial Consultants (Royce Geo), a geospatial intelligence and data fusion leader — brings more than 20 years of experience and a track record of accelerating commercial and national security space data analytics through artificial intelligence and machine learning. A former National Geospatial-Intelligence Agency (NGA) senior analyst and geospatial lead at KeyW (now Jacobs), Sterling propelled Royce Geo forward by winning major contracts with the NGA and Space Force.

“Phil and Dave are exactly the type of strategic partners GRVTY needs to scale our mission-critical capabilities,” said Katie Selbe, chief executive officer of GRVTY. “Their leadership and mission knowledge across the Defense and Intelligence Communities brings deep operational insight and technical vision that align perfectly with GRVTY’s purpose: to advance and accelerate national security to protect what we value most. I’m honored to welcome them as founding members of our advisory board.”

On March 12, Arlington Capital Partners announced the formation of GRVTY, a next generation leader in defense technology solutions for national security priorities across the Department of Defense, Intelligence Community and Homeland Security.

GRVTY supports the U.S. government’s growing intelligence, surveillance, reconnaissance and targeting (ISR&T) challenges with advanced capabilities in geospatial intelligence (GEOINT), signals intelligence (SIGINT) and cyber combined with proven expertise to solve complex national security mission challenges. The company is led by CEO Katie Selbe, who has held senior leadership roles at two prior Arlington portfolio companies.

“At a time when the country is facing an increasingly complex national security environment, it is more important than ever for decisionmakers to receive rapid and trusted intelligence and analysis,” said Katie Selbe, CEO of GRVTY. “GRVTY was created to deliver American dominance from outer space to cyberspace, and I look forward to delivering critical situational awareness to support our customers’ national security missions.”

“GRVTY will deliver innovation at speed and scale to support our national security customers,” said David Wodlinger, a managing partner at Arlington Capital Partners. “We plan to provide significant resources to GRVTY as it grows rapidly to become the next major defense technology company.”

GRVTY has over 325 employees across eleven states with primary locations including Arlington, Va., Annapolis Junction, Md., Dulles, Va., Chantilly, Va., Springfield, Va. and St. Louis and has more than $100 million in revenue.
